Economy & Jobs
Wilsonville residents earn a median household income of $65,417 , which is 13% below the national average of $75,149.
Per capita income is $32,791. The unemployment rate stands at 9.1% (153% above the U.S. rate of 3.6%). 8.1% of residents live below the poverty line. The area is home to 7,251 business establishments, including 436 restaurants.
Housing & Cost of Living
The median home value in Wilsonville is $238,500 , 15% below the national median of $281,900.
Zillow estimates the typical home at $336,731. Median rent is $879/month, with 28.4% of renters spending more than 30% of income on housing. The cost of living index is 88.8 (100 = national average). The median home was built in 1992.

Climate & Weather
Wilsonville has an average annual temperature of 65°F (18°C).
Winters average 46°F in January while summers reach 82°F in July. The area gets 304 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 56.0 inches.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 41.
